Shelve The Strike: Oba Olugbenle Appeals To Ogun Workers

The Chairman of Ogun State Obas Council, His Royal Highness, Oba Kehinde Olugbenle has appealed to the Ogun State branch of Nigerian Labour Congress and Trade Union Council to shelve the ongoing strike action and give room for a dialogue/fresh negotiation with the State Government.

The appeal came during the Scaling-Up of “Araya”, a Community Base Health Insurance Scheme (CBHIS) at Asade Agunloye Pavilion Empire Field in Ilaro, Ogun State.

Olugbenle said as much as the State Government understand the plight of the Civil servant, the Union should also put into consideration the present economic situation of the State in particular the Country.

Performing the official symbolic presentation of the card to the beneficiaries, Oba Olugbenle call on all pregnant women and parents whose children are under the age of 5 to register for the “Araya” programme, advising other States to emulate Ogun State.
Commenting on the programme, Senator Iyabo Anisulowo, said the news of Araya CBHIS got to her in London.

While applauded the Ibikunle Amosun’s led administration for the good initiatives, Anisulowo urges Yewa citizens to take advantage of the free programme particularly those living below poverty level. She said the programme is first of its kind in the State.
Leading the delegation, Speaker of the Ogun State House Assembly, Rt. Hon. Suraj Adekunbi, said the gesture of the present administration was part of its promises to the good people of Ogun at providing affordable, good and qualitative health care services.
In his good will message, the State Commissioner for Health, Dr. Babatunde Ipaye, said the State Government has approved the sum of N100 million to register pregnant women and Children under 5 free of charge.
Ipaye said the scheme which was recognise locally and Internationally has received appraisal from the Federal Government, adding that the Ministry has been called upon by the FG to showcase the achievement of Araya for other States to emulate.
